CDB35L00-X4 W x 4 CS35L00 Amplifier Demonstration Board Contains 4 CS35L00 Hybrid Class-D Amplifiers Selectable +6 dB or +12 dB Gain Selectable Operational Modes Device Shutdown Control Delivers W/Ch into 4 at 10 % THD+N Delivers W/Ch into 8 at 10 % THD+N Differential Mono Analog Inputs for each CS35L00 Amplifier Demonstrates Recommended 4-Layer Layout and Grounding Arrangements Optional Output Filter Connections Optional Gain Adjustment Resistors Powered by Single V Power Supply The CDB35L00-X4 demonstrates the CS35L00 high-efficiency Hybrid Class-D audio amplifier. This demonstration board implements a four-channel, quad amplifier system that delivers W per full-bridge channel into loads using a single +5 V supply. Differential audio inputs can easily be connected through the J10, J20, J30, and J40 headers. If desired, the gain can be adjusted through the optional input resistors. Component landings are available for an optional EMI output filter. The CDB35L00-X4 can be configured to evaluate the four operational modes and two gain settings of the CS35L00 amplifier. Mode, Gain, and Shutdown control is available through the S1 switch. Hybrid control is available through the R13, R23, R33, and R43 resistors.
